An .htaccess file is a text file that contains directives that tell a server how to operate in specific cases. It should be put in the folder in which these directives should be performed. Numerous script-driven apps employ this kind of a file to function efficiently - WordPress and Joomla™, for instance. You can use this type of a file with custom made content as well and do a lot of things - block an IP address, a whole network or certain websites from accessing your site, set personalized error pages which shall appear rather than server-generated ones if a visitor encounters some error on the website, redirect a domain or a subdomain to a different web address, create a password-protected area and much more. With an .htaccess file, you will have much better control over your world-wide web presence.
